在当今数字化时代,移动应用开发已经成为一项非常热门的技能。Android作为全球使用最广泛的操作系统之一,拥有庞大的用户群体和丰富的开发资源。学会Android编程,不仅可以让你轻松解决手机应用开发难题,还能开启你在移动互联网领域的新征程。下面,就让我们一起探索Android编程的奥秘。
初识Android开发环境
在开始Android编程之前,你需要了解并配置好开发环境。以下是Android开发环境的搭建步骤:
- 下载Android Studio:Android Studio是官方推荐的Android开发工具,提供了丰富的功能,如代码编辑、调试、性能分析等。
- 安装JDK:Java开发工具包(JDK)是Android开发的基础,你需要下载并安装相应版本的JDK。
- 配置环境变量:将JDK的bin目录路径添加到系统环境变量中,以便在命令行中直接运行Java命令。
- 下载Android SDK:在Android Studio中,你需要下载对应的Android SDK,以便在项目中使用Android API。
Android编程基础
Android编程主要使用Java语言,以下是Android编程的基础知识:
- Android应用结构:Android应用主要由四大组件构成:Activity(活动)、Service(服务)、BroadcastReceiver(广播接收器)和ContentProvider(内容提供者)。
- 布局文件:布局文件定义了Android应用的界面结构,通常使用XML语言编写。
- AndroidManifest.xml:该文件声明了应用的基本信息,如应用的名称、版本、权限等。
实战案例:制作一个简单的Android应用
以下是一个简单的Android应用案例,用于演示Android编程的基本步骤:
- 创建项目:在Android Studio中创建一个新的项目,选择“Empty Activity”模板。
- 编写布局:在res/layout目录下创建activity_main.xml文件,定义应用的界面结构。
- 编写代码:在MainActivity.java文件中编写代码,实现应用的逻辑功能。
- 运行应用:点击运行按钮,在模拟器或真机上运行应用。
高级技巧与进阶
随着你对Android编程的深入了解,你可以学习以下高级技巧和进阶知识:
- 使用Android Studio插件:Android Studio提供了丰富的插件,可以帮助你提高开发效率。
- 掌握Android API:Android API提供了丰富的功能,你可以根据需求选择合适的API进行开发。
- 学习Android性能优化:了解Android性能优化技巧,提高应用的运行效率。
- 学习Android安全性:了解Android安全机制,提高应用的安全性。
总结
学会Android编程,可以让你轻松解决手机应用开发难题。通过不断学习和实践,你将能够掌握更多的开发技巧,为你的职业生涯打开新的大门。希望本文能对你有所帮助,祝你学习顺利!